Apollo Electronics Corporation Ltd is a trusted provider of Contract Electronics Manufacturing, offering reliable and efficient services for the assembly and testing of electronic products. We support various industries in delivering high-quality electronics on time and within budget. Our end-to-end manufacturing solutions include design for manufacture reviews, PCB assembly, component sourcing through a trusted supply chain, and functional testing, providing turnkey solutions. Utilizing advanced technologies such as automated SMT machines and wave soldering, we deliver excellence from concept to finished product, ensuring customer satisfaction.Role DescriptionWe are seeking a skilled Electronics Technician for a full-time, on-site position at our facility located in Calgary, AB. Responsibilities include troubleshooting and repairing electronic systems, performing soldering tasks for both surface mount and through-hole components, and ensuring the maintenance and repair of electronic equipment. The technician will collaborate with other team members to maintain operational standards and quality control in the production process.QualificationsStrong competency in Electronics Technology and Electricity conceptsProficiency in Soldering and experience with various soldering techniques (e.g., surface mount and through-hole)Skills in Troubleshooting electronic components and systemsExperience in Maintenance & Repair of electronic equipmentAttention to detail and commitment to quality in all tasksEffective communication and collaboration with team membersProven ability to adapt to a fast‑paced manufacturing environmentPost‑secondary diploma or certification in Electronics Technology or a related field is preferred #J-18808-Ljbffr
